    While looking through boards I see that there are a large amount of threads on topics or discussion that should be kept to one thread so the boards would be less cluttered and better for navigation. I think the quality of the forums would go up if Forum Guards or capable users created megathreads. Someone makes one if they noticed discussions that would be better kept in one thread, of course one should only do it if they see the potential for success.
    Original topics would show better without a lot of threads similar to each other scattered through every page.

    In Help there would be a thread for each OS, common errors and fixes would be listed in the OP of each with links or quoted text on the issue and how to fix it or whats causing it. People would also just post about there issue if they can't find it in the OP and then get the response there.

    In General a Premium Account discussion for people who are buying it, bought it, curious about it, etc as many people seem to make threads trying to get convinced to buy premium or for whatever reason asking about what you get.
    A thread for discussion on future updates would be able to hold all of the topics in the countless threads in one ongoing place.

    I think you can get the basic idea, you just need to look at each board, or your board of choice to see that there are a lot of redundant threads that would be better kept in one place.

    I'm not trying to convey it as everything needs a megathread, just for things that are widely talked about that would be better in its own place.
